Road and Race Italian Motorcycles

Ducati Instrument Panel for 750SS 74-75

Instrument_Panel_Ducati_750SS_1974-75.jpg
Index page [< Previous] [Next >]

Copyright © 1997-2024 Road and Race. Site by dropbears